What is the tradition of the wedding cake topper?

The tradition of the wedding cake topper originated in the Victorian era when couples began adding small figures of the bride and groom to the top of their wedding cakes to symbolise their unity. The practice gained popularity in the United States in the early 20th century, with the wedding cake toppers typically representing the couple standing side-by-side as a sign of their partnership and shared future. Do wedding cakes need toppers?

No, wedding cakes don't need toppers! Wedding cake toppers are optional; you can choose to have one or not based on your preference, style, or cake. While some love the tradition or the chance to add their stamp to their wedding cake, others prefer a minimalist look or to showcase intricate cake designs without the extra adornment.

How do I choose a wedding cake topper?

When choosing a wedding cake topper, you should consider what will best reflect your personality as a couple and the style or theme of your wedding.

Wedding toppers for cakes are a great way to instil a part of your personality into your wedding cake. If you're family orientated, love pets or a specific hobby or sport, it's easy to find wedding cake toppers that reflect you as a couple. You can also get Mr & Mrs, Mr & Mr or Mrs & Mrs wedding cake toppers to reflect your relationship.

If you want your wedding cake topper to match the style or theme of your wedding, think about colours; whether you want gold, silver, white, blush pink, black or natural wood, choose one that reflects your colour scheme. Or, select one based on your wedding style, whether modern, traditional, boho or rustic.
